While we are at it, I wish that the Axsr forend was either 1 Keyslot slot longer, or 5 Keyslot slots longer.
1 additional slot would allow the installation of 5 AI weights with each nut properly installed and supported. Currently, you end up with one weight only secured by one nut and hanging off the back or front of your rail (depending on how you staggered the weights). Yeah the Axsr isn’t designed for gamer stuff and adding weights for balance or tracking is a gamer thing, but lots of people choose this platform for ELR comps. It’s just nicer to shoot a heavier, better balanced hot rod 300NM all day than a lighter, less balanced one. With a full stack of weights and the factory 27” 300NM barrel, my gun recoils and tracks like a 6.5cm. Very nice for ELR heavy ways where high round count, spotting impacts, and maintaining composure lever the day is necessary. Plus the weights allow the gun to be dropped on a bag and balance better when I’m shooting 308 or 6mm. I hate checking that the weight is still on the gun after every stage since it’s only held on by one slot.
5 additional slots would allow the same thing, with the ability to add a 6th weight. Would be super nice.
Yeah the AT-X is their comp focused gun, yeah the AXSR isn’t used as much in comps, etc, but not being able to fully support a full stack of AI’s own weights on the forend is a little disappointing. I have encountered several scenarios where an additional weight out front would be nice without the width penalty of double stacking.

They have their AX50 ELR spec’d with a heavy trigger, a forend tube that’s like ~13” long, and a 27” 50BMG (most ELR shooters do not like anything about that cartridge design). Ok all that’s fine for an HTI mission which btw is not a common mission whatsoever, so I struggle to even see the military/LE demand but I guess gov money has the print button to buy whatever.
Anyone who is into ELR competitions and has built custom rifles for it would criticize instantly: trigger needs to be much lighter and the forend tube needs to be like 16-18” long. Someone is going to throw a 36-40” barrel on the thing if they’re going to use it in competition. They want the bipod far out for stability.
The rifle is what ~$15k after tax? Then someone is going to dumb another $1.5k to get a 416B barrel. Then buy a bipod extender because the forend is so short. It just doesn’t even make sense.
